Performance Benchmarks Show Real-World Gains

Windows 11 24H2, also known as the 2024 Update, brings substantial performance enhancements that users can actually feel. Independent testing reveals application launches completing up to 10% faster compared to Windows 11 23H2. File copy operations show even more dramatic improvements, with some benchmarks indicating 25% faster transfers for large files and complex folder structures.

Gaming performance receives particular attention in this update. Microsoft has optimized the Windows graphics stack and memory management, resulting in measurable frame rate improvements across multiple titles. Early adopters report smoother gameplay and reduced stuttering, especially in resource-intensive games. The update also includes refinements to the DirectStorage API, accelerating load times for games that support the technology.

These performance gains stem from multiple under-the-hood improvements. Microsoft has refined the Windows scheduler for better CPU core utilization, optimized memory management algorithms, and improved storage driver performance. The cumulative effect creates a noticeably snappier user experience, particularly on systems with solid-state drives.

AI Integration Through Copilot+ PC Features

Windows 11 24H2 represents Microsoft's most significant AI integration to date. The update introduces Copilot+ PC capabilities that leverage neural processing units (NPUs) in compatible hardware. These features include Recall, a system that creates a searchable visual history of everything users see on their PC, and Cocreator, which helps generate and edit images using natural language prompts.

Live Captions now support real-time translation for over 40 languages directly in any audio or video content. Windows Studio Effects brings AI-powered background blur, eye contact correction, and automatic framing to video calls. These features require specific hardware with dedicated NPUs, marking a clear direction toward specialized AI computing in Windows devices.

Microsoft has integrated AI throughout the operating system. File Explorer gains enhanced search capabilities that understand natural language queries. The Photos app includes advanced editing tools powered by AI. Even basic system functions like power management and thermal control now incorporate machine learning algorithms to optimize performance based on usage patterns.

Installation Issues and Compatibility Concerns

Despite the performance improvements, the Windows 11 24H2 update has encountered installation problems for some users. Multiple reports indicate failed installations, system crashes during the update process, and compatibility issues with certain hardware configurations. The most common problems involve systems with older processors or unconventional hardware combinations.

Microsoft has acknowledged these issues and released several patches to address installation failures. The company recommends users ensure their systems meet the minimum requirements before attempting the update, particularly the TPM 2.0 and Secure Boot requirements that remain from previous Windows 11 versions. Users with custom-built PCs or older enterprise hardware appear most affected by compatibility problems.

Data backup has proven crucial for those attempting the update. Several users reported data loss when installation failures corrupted system partitions. Microsoft's official guidance emphasizes creating full system backups before upgrading, though many users discovered this advice only after encountering problems.

Security Enhancements and Privacy Considerations

Windows 11 24H2 includes substantial security improvements beyond the AI features. Microsoft has enhanced Windows Defender with better ransomware protection and more sophisticated threat detection algorithms. The update also brings improvements to Windows Hello facial recognition and fingerprint authentication, with faster recognition times and better accuracy in varying lighting conditions.

Privacy concerns have emerged around some of the new AI features, particularly Recall. This feature captures screenshots of user activity to create a searchable timeline, raising questions about data storage and access. Microsoft has implemented multiple privacy controls, including local-only processing for Recall data and the ability to exclude specific applications or websites from being captured.

Enterprise users benefit from enhanced security management tools. Windows 11 24H2 improves integration with Microsoft Defender for Endpoint and adds more granular control over security policies. The update also includes better support for hardware-based security features like Pluton security processors.

Hardware Requirements and Optimization

The Windows 11 24H2 update maintains the same minimum hardware requirements as previous Windows 11 versions, but truly benefiting from the new AI features requires Copilot+ PC certified hardware. These systems need at least 16GB of RAM, 256GB of storage, and most importantly, an NPU capable of 40 TOPS (trillion operations per second) of AI performance.

Microsoft has optimized the update for both new and existing hardware. Systems without dedicated NPUs still receive performance improvements and can use cloud-powered versions of some AI features. However, the most advanced capabilities like real-time translation and AI-powered creative tools require the local processing power of Copilot+ PC hardware.

Gamers will appreciate the continued support for DirectX 12 Ultimate and Auto HDR, with improvements to both technologies in this update. Microsoft has also worked with hardware partners to ensure better driver compatibility and performance optimization for the latest graphics cards from AMD, Intel, and NVIDIA.

Enterprise Deployment and Management

For organizations, Windows 11 24H2 brings improved deployment tools and management capabilities. Microsoft has enhanced Windows Autopilot for smoother device provisioning and added more configuration options to Intune. The update also includes better compatibility with existing enterprise applications, addressing one of the major concerns from business users during previous Windows 11 updates.

IT administrators gain more control over AI feature deployment. Organizations can choose which Copilot+ PC capabilities to enable and can configure privacy settings at scale through group policies. Microsoft has also improved reporting and monitoring tools to help IT departments track update deployment and identify compatibility issues before they affect users.

Long-term support remains a consideration for enterprise adoption. Windows 11 24H2 follows Microsoft's standard support lifecycle, with 24 months of support for regular releases and 36 months for enterprise and education editions. Organizations planning deployment should factor in this timeline when considering their upgrade strategies.

User Experience Refinements

Beyond the major features, Windows 11 24H2 includes numerous quality-of-life improvements. The Start menu and taskbar receive subtle refinements for better usability. File Explorer gains additional view options and improved performance when handling large numbers of files. The Settings app has been reorganized for easier navigation, with frequently accessed options more readily available.

Microsoft has addressed several user interface inconsistencies that plagued earlier Windows 11 versions. Context menus now have more consistent styling across applications, and animation performance has been optimized for smoother visual transitions. These refinements create a more polished experience that feels cohesive rather than piecemeal.

Accessibility features receive significant attention in this update. New voice access capabilities allow complete hands-free control of Windows, and improved screen reader performance makes the operating system more usable for visually impaired users. Microsoft has also enhanced color filters and text size options for users with specific visual needs.
